Comparison review

Motorola One Hyper has a score of 79.8, which is a little bit better than vivo X Fold 3 Pro's overall score of 77.8. Although Motorola One Hyper is much older and way thicker than the vivo X Fold 3 Pro, it's construction is still a little bit lighter. Both of these phones work with Android OS, but Motorola One Hyper has older 11 version while vivo X Fold 3 Pro has Android 14 version.

Vivo X Fold 3 Pro features a much more vibrant display than Motorola One Hyper, because it has a bigger display, a little higher pixels number per inch in the display and a way better 2200 x 2480 resolution. Motorola One Hyper features a very superior processing unit than vivo X Fold 3 Pro, although it has a smaller amount of RAM memory, they both have 8 processing cores.

Vivo X Fold 3 Pro counts with a bigger storage capacity to store more apps and games than Motorola One Hyper, because although it has no slot for SD memory cards, it also counts with more internal memory. Vivo X Fold 3 Pro features a superior battery lifetime than Motorola One Hyper, because it has a 43% more battery capacity.

The vivo X Fold 3 Pro captures much clearer pictures and videos than Motorola One Hyper, because although it has a lot less mega-pixels resolution back facing camera, it also counts with a much better video resolution and a bigger aperture to take better low light images.
